> > > Anyway, is there a tool that is comparable to SpeedFan for Windows?
> > > Something that lets me control the speed of my CPU fan?
> > >
> > > Thanks in advance!
> > >
> > > Florian Philipp
> >
> > Don't know what SpeedFan does but fancontrol is part of lm_sensors. 
> > Check man fan_control.  To kick it in, add it to your rc-update scripts:
> > rc-update -a fancontrol, but would be a good idea to have sorted out its
> > configuration first.  Also, you may need to have switched fan control off
> > in your BIOS.
> >
> > Of course if your MoBo is not recognised by lm_sensors (mine isn't) then
> > I don't know if there's anything else you can do.
